Tech support by average joes with Fixya
How many times have you been befuddled with a product, only to result to the dreaded 1-800 number in the manual to resolve your issue? Hours later only to find no resolution in sight. Enter Fixya, a startup that has taken on the challenge of supplying online technical support, user guides and repairs by letting users help each other. In a few simple steps users get the help they need with their items by submitting product related questions from a catalog of over 700,000 current consumer products, ranging from baby items to electronic gadgets. Other users can then choose to answer questions to the best of their knowledge, with experts standing by.
